•v_5 <br />Keep ell heavy equipment off of the proposed treatment area before and after <br />construction. The treatment area should be marked off before construction. This <br />Design is not valid & the system wiO need to be relocated if failure to protect the areas <br />proposed for On-Site Sew^ Treatment occurs. <br />WHh proper installation and maintenance, this system should have no problem in <br />treating septic effluent effectively. <br />Nothing other than human waste, toilet tissue, laundry, showers, water softener etc. <br />should be disposed of into the septic tanks. Iron filters must be diverted out of the <br />system. Garbage disposals are not recommended, due to adding more solids & fine <br />solids passing through to the system. Excessive amounts of soaps, anti-bacterial <br />soaps, cleaning agents & chlorine agen*s may km the bacteria needed to treat septic <br />effluent. Additives are not recommended. Recommend to pump & dean your tanks <br />through the manhole by a certified pumper every 2 years. Check with your pumper to <br />set up a schedule. <br />Steven B. Schirmers <br />^ cl i •
